Appraiser Comments: Hello there,
If your is an original (1924) the price is considerably different from the re-issue which was done in 1985.  The bottle originally was made by Rene' Lalique in France for the Worth perfume company.  The below valu reflect MINT condition and that it is an original 1924 issue.

* Current Fair Market Value is the amount someone might receive when selling their item to a dealer or at auction. It is also the amount most government tax agencies (IRS, Revenue Canada, Inland Revenue, etc.) recognize as the tax deductible amount were the item donated to a charitable organization.

** Replacement Cost is the retail amount one might reasonably pay to purchase the item from a dealer, gallery, store, etc. It is also the amount for which one may want to insure an item.
